发明名称 METHOD FOR DETERMINATION OF OXIDATIVE STRESS
摘要 <p>Disclosed is a biomarker which enables the prevention of tissue damage or cell necrosis by administration of a medicine and also enables the easy and rapid detection of the presence of oxidative stress placed on a living body, and which is a promising marker for the examination of pharmacokinetics of various substances. It is known that the level of ophthalmic acid in the blood varies depending on the concentration of reduced glutathione (GSH) in a biological sample. The presence or absence of oxidative stress can be determined by measuring the ophthalmic acid level in the blood on an analyzer such as a capillary electrophoresis-mass spectrometer or the like. Further, an anti-oxidative stress agent can be screened by administering a candidate substance for the anti-oxidative stress agent to a non-human animal suffering from oxidative stress, determining the ophthalmic acid level in the blood in the animal, and evaluating the degree of decrease in ophthalmic acid level in the animal.</p>
